Spring Boot 2.7.18(最终 2.x 系列版本):版本概览;兼容性与支持;升级建议;脚手架工程搭建

Spring Boot 2.7.18(最终 2.x 系列版本)

Spring Boot 2.7.18(最终 2.x 系列版本)

Spring Boot 官网https://spring.io/projects/spring-boot

一、版本概览

  • 版本号:2.7.18
  • 发布日期:2023‑11‑23
  • 特性:包含 ~43 项 bug 修复、文档改进与依赖升级。
  • 说明:这是 Spring Boot 2 系列的 最后一个开源支持版本。建议尽早升级至 3.x 系列。

二、兼容性与支持

  • Java 版本:支持 Java 8 起,并兼容至 Java 21(含)范围。
  • Spring Boot 2.x 系列已结束开源支持;如仍需使用,可考虑商业支持。
  • 若计划迁移至 Spring Boot 3 系列,请参考官方迁移指南。

三、升级建议

  1. 检查当前项目中所用的 Spring Boot 版本,若低于 2.7.18,建议先升级至 2.7.18 以获取最新修复。
  2. 确保项目所使用的依赖版本(如 Spring Framework、JDBC 驱动等)与 2.7.18 兼容。
  3. 长期来看,建议迁移至 Spring Boot 3.x 系列,享受新特性、长期支持与现代 Java 版本优化。

四、Maven 依赖示例

xml 复制代码
<dependency>
  <groupId>org.springframework.boot</groupId>
  <artifactId>spring-boot-starter</artifactId>
  <version>2.7.18</version>
</dependency>

五、脚手架工程搭建

相关推荐
天若有情6732 小时前
新闻通稿 | 软件产业迈入“智能重构”新纪元:自主进化、人机共生与责任挑战并存
服务器·前端·后端·重构·开发·资讯·新闻
2301_796512523 小时前
Rust编程学习 - 如何利用代数类型系统做错误处理的另外一大好处是可组合性(composability)
java·学习·rust
清水3 小时前
Spring Boot企业级开发入门
java·spring boot·后端
一个不称职的程序猿3 小时前
高并发场景下的缓存利器
java·缓存
星释3 小时前
Rust 练习册 :Proverb与字符串处理
开发语言·后端·rust
Q_Q5110082854 小时前
python+django/flask的校园活动中心场地预约系统
spring boot·python·django·flask·node.js·php
2301_801252224 小时前
Tomcat的基本使用作用
java·tomcat
lkbhua莱克瓦244 小时前
Java基础——常用算法3
java·数据结构·笔记·算法·github·排序算法·学习方法
麦麦鸡腿堡4 小时前
Java_TreeSet与TreeMap源码解读
java·开发语言